## Artifact Signing and Wiki Roles

On the Thistledown wiki, only members of the `release-stewards` role may attach signed artifacts to published pages. Editors can draft release notes, but the attachment step verifies the uploader's role and the artifact's signature before the page goes live. Future maintainers: never widen these role bindings without a recorded review, and rotate credentials whenever a steward departs. Audit entries live under the Provenance namespace. The signing key currently trusted by the verification hook is shown below.

deploy key for kajof-fajop: bky6_gDHw9Q

## Deep-Link Routing

The Skylarch mobile router maps inbound links to screens via the route manifest, versioned per release. Unknown paths fall back to the home screen; never 404 in-app. Universal links require the association file to match the bundle ID exactly, or routing silently fails on cold start. Keep the manifest and the web redirect table in sync — drift causes loops. Link payloads are signed before dispatch, and the router verifies them with a secret set in the env file on the next line.

vault entry, yahif-yajep: COURIER_KEY29=b802bdf8034096b65a51c6ba5abe2

## Crossword Generator — Access Overview

For review: the Gridsmith crossword generator is an internal batch service. It pulls word lists from the Lexivault API, generates grids nightly, and writes output to a read-only store. No user data is processed. Scope is limited to lexicon reads. The service authenticates to Lexivault with the following key.

API key for yahig-tadup: kto7_ubizbYm

## Health checks — Larkspur API

The balancer probes /healthz every 5s; two consecutive failures pull the node. Do not restart the whole pool — drain one node at a time or you'll flap the upstream checks too. If all nodes report unhealthy, check the Quillbase connection first; the probe fails closed when the DB handshake times out. Grace period after deploy is 30s, so ignore alerts inside that window. The probe and pool settings currently in effect are listed below.

service settings:
[casax]
port = 6379
team = rusir
host = casax.zemvarhq.corp
region = outer-4
access_code = ac_9808ce
timeout_ms = 1500